Dilution is the process of decreasing the concentration of a solution by increasing the volume of the solvent.
When a solution is diluted, additional solvent is added, which results in an increase in the total volume of the solution. However, the amount of solute—the substance that is dissolved—remains constant. Consequently, this leads to a decrease in the concentration of the solution. Concentration is defined as the amount of solute per unit volume of solution. Therefore, when the volume of the solution increases while the amount of solute stays the same, the concentration inevitably decreases.
For instance, consider a saltwater solution with a specific concentration. If you add more water to this solution, the quantity of salt does not change. However, the salt becomes distributed throughout a larger volume of water, resulting in a lower concentration of salt in the solution.
This concept is significant in numerous areas of chemistry, especially in analytical chemistry, where diluting solutions is often necessary to facilitate analysis. It is also relevant in everyday situations, such as when preparing a squash drink; you dilute the concentrated squash with water to achieve a more palatable flavor.
It is essential to remember that the process of dilution does not alter the total amount of solute present in the solution; it merely redistributes it over a greater volume. This redistribution is why the concentration decreases. Additionally, it is important to note that dilution is a physical change rather than a chemical one. The chemical properties of the solute remain unchanged during dilution; only its concentration is affected.
